I can get some fairly thick sounds from my APS1s and APS2 bridge. If you are wanting single sized buckers though:

59--classic bucker sound

Cool Rails--this is tonally between a 59 and a Hot rails lots of bass but still smooth

JBjr--This is a juiced up 59, it's thick and rich and sound great in the Bridge. The neck version sounds nice too. Listen to Maiden's Rock in Rio Blood brothers solo by Gers

Hot Rails--Thick, heavy, lots of bass. Listen to anything with Dave Murray

Pentachris, there are no rules per se, just try to get what sounds good to you. I try to have less output in the neck and middle slot. My buddy has a guitar with a cool rails neck and hot rails middle. It sounds pretty good. The Cool Rails has a lot of bass almost as much as the hot rails.

I'd go with the JBjr middle and 59 neck, sticking with rails I'd go with two cool rails. OR hot stack middle, classic stack neck if I wanted a more vintage type tone.
